⁣⁣Lesson Plan: Exposed: 5 Game Show Cheaters Caught on Live TV with Their Secrets Revealed!

Grade Level: 9-12

Objective: To examine the phenomenon of game show cheating, exploring real-life instances where contestants were caught cheating on live television. This lesson aims to develop critical thinking, media literacy, and ethical reasoning skills by analyzing the motivations behind cheating and the impact it has on the integrity of game shows.

Common Core Standards:
- CCSS.ELA-LITERACY.RI.9-10.8: Delineate and evaluate the argument and specific claims in a text, assessing whether the reasoning is valid and the evidence is relevant and sufficient.
- CCSS.ELA-LITERACY.SL.11-12.3: Evaluate a speaker's point of view, reasoning, and use of evidence and rhetoric.

Materials:
- Access to videos or articles showcasing instances of game show cheating
- Worksheets for note-taking and reflection
- Devices with internet access for video viewing (optional)

Procedure:

1. Introduction (10 minutes)
- Begin the lesson by discussing the concept of game show cheating and its impact on the integrity of competitions.
- Ask students if they are familiar with any instances where game show contestants were caught cheating on live television.
- Introduce the topic of 5 game show cheaters who were exposed, highlighting the ethical concerns and the consequences they faced.

2. Video Viewing and Note-Taking (30 minutes)
- Show selected videos or provide articles that detail the instances of game show cheating, one by one, or provide students with access to the content for individual viewing.
- Instruct students to take notes while watching each video or reading each article, identifying the cheating methods used and the consequences faced by the cheaters.

3. Analysis and Discussion (20 minutes)
- Facilitate a class discussion about each instance of game show cheating, encouraging students to share their thoughts and reactions.
- Guide the discussion to analyze the motivations behind cheating and the impact it has on the fairness and integrity of game shows.
- Encourage students to evaluate the reasoning and evidence presented in the videos or articles, assessing the validity of claims made.

4. Individual Reflection (15 minutes)
- Distribute worksheets that require students to individually reflect on each instance of game show cheating and provide their analysis and evaluation.
- Instruct students to write an informative/explanatory text discussing their thoughts on the cheaters' motivations, the impact of cheating on game shows, and the ethical implications of their actions.

5. Peer Review and Feedback (10 minutes)
- Pair students up and have them exchange their written responses.
- Instruct students to provide constructive feedback on each other's analysis, suggesting ways to strengthen their arguments or consider alternative perspectives.
- Emphasize the importance of respectful and thoughtful feedback.

6. Revision and Final Draft (15 minutes)
- Provide time for students to revise their written responses based on the feedback received.
- Encourage students to incorporate the suggestions and strengthen their analysis with additional details or counterarguments.
- Instruct students to create a final draft of their written responses.

7. Conclusion (5 minutes)
- Summarize the main points discussed in the lesson, emphasizing the importance of integrity, fairness, and ethical decision-making in game shows.
- Encourage students to critically evaluate the media they consume and the actions of individuals, seeking a deeper understanding of complex situations.
